Python
ninn-sang
这个作者很懒,什么都没留下…
展开
-
Python 获取日期函数
from datetime import datetime, date, timedelta# import calendardef gen_date(): dt=datetime.now()#创建一个datetime类对象 # current month today= dt.strftime('%Y%m%d') today_= dt.strftime('%Y-%m-%d') yesterday = (dt + timedelta(days = -1) ).原创 2021-05-31 14:33:30 · 392 阅读 · 0 评论 -
Jupyter notebook改变默认路径
1. 打开anaconda prompt,输入jupyter notebook --generate-config获取jupyter notebook注册文件地址2. 进入改地址,右击用文本打开该文件3. ctrl+f搜索NotebookApp.notebook_dir,找到后,去掉#注释,改成想要的路径,如c.NotebookApp.notebook_dir = u'E:\\Jupyter'4. jupyter图标,右击属性,加上路径...原创 2021-05-06 11:37:27 · 89 阅读 · 0 评论 -
Jupyter Notebook 语法大全(含Markdown)
Jupyter Notebook命令模式下的快键键:Enter: 转入编辑模式 Shift-Enter: 运行本单元,选中下个单元Ctrl-Enter: 运行本单元Alt-Enter: 运行本单元,在其下插入新单元Y: 单元转入代码状态(非编辑模式,编辑模式下先按Esc键,再按Y)M...原创 2021-03-23 11:31:06 · 10037 阅读 · 0 评论 -
【解决方案】64位Python连接32位Oracle报错 cx_Oracle.DatabaseError: DPI-1047
64位 Python3.8 连接32位Oracle 11g时,报错信息如下:cx_Oracle.DatabaseError: DPI-1047: Cannot locate a 64-bit Oracle Client library解决方法:cx_Oracle和python版本对应,都是3.8; Python 3.8.3 cx_Oracle-8.1.0-cp38-cp38-win_amd64.whl cx_Oracle和instantclient版本对应,都是11.2; i.原创 2021-01-04 19:12:27 · 3164 阅读 · 3 评论 -
[问题解决] Openpyxl操作Excel合并单元格边框缺失
[问题解决] Openpyxl操作Excel合并单元格边框缺失anaconda自带openpyxl库,3.6版python中openpyxl是2.4.10该版本openpyxl在打开Excel并保存时,如Excel中有合并单元格,则单元格的边框会部分缺失最新版的2.6.2以解决这个问题,具体升级库的方法:卸载原版本pip uninstall openpyxl获取最新版openpyxlh...原创 2019-04-21 00:19:01 · 2895 阅读 · 3 评论 -
Ubuntu 16.04 默认python3 设置
Ubuntu默认是python2.7,使用下面两个语句可实现设置python3为默认:sudo update-alternatives --install /usr/bin/python python /usr/bin/python2 100sudo update-alternatives --install /usr/bin/python python /usr/bin/python3...原创 2018-12-25 13:04:00 · 251 阅读 · 0 评论 -
sublime自动跳出括号、单引号、双引号设置
打开Preferences->Key Bindings-User,如果已经有别的系统设置,需在大括号后加 “,” 再输入编辑内容,如下:第一段是设置F8作为执行键;第二段是设置自动跳出括号、单引号、双引号。[ { "keys":["f8"], "caption":"SublimeREPL:Python - RUN current file"...原创 2018-10-18 15:33:17 · 2613 阅读 · 0 评论 -
python 字符串拼接总结
1、加号连接>>> a, b = 'hello', ' world'>>> a + b'hello world'2、逗号连接>>> a, b = 'hello', ' world'>>> print(a, b)hello world>>> a, bhello world转载 2018-07-24 21:43:12 · 378 阅读 · 0 评论 -
sublime运行python程序控制台输入问题
1、安装SublimeREPL插件Ctrl+shift+p 键入 install packages,再继续键入 SublimeREPL 安装即可。这些操作之后,每次编译运行的操作是:tools->sublimeREPL->python->python-Run current file。点击之后会出现新的页面*REPL*[python],作为新的控制台,可以输入输出互动。...原创 2018-07-24 21:21:58 · 1800 阅读 · 1 评论 -
Windows下Python安装库的几种方法
1、pip安装(最常用的安装方式)win+R 输入cmd,打开命令行窗口,输入 pip install ×××(eg. pandas)既可以让Python自动安装相应的库,如果出现timeout的报错,需要重复输入。2、easy_install安装方法同1,输入内容为 easy_install ×××。3、conda安装安装anaconda的情况下,可以用conda inst...原创 2018-06-20 13:25:48 · 15708 阅读 · 1 评论